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ician in California

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ician Schools in California

76 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ician students earned their degrees in the state in 2022-2023.

In terms of popularity,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ician is the 928th most popular major in the state out of a total 1028 majors commonly available.

Education Levels of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ician Majors in California

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ician majors in the state tend to have the following degree levels:

Education Level Number of Grads
Award Taking Less Than 1 Year 68
Award Taking 1 to 2 Years 8
Award Taking 2 to 4 Years 8

Racial Distribution

The racial distribution of electrocardiograph technology/technician majors in California is as follows:

  • Asian: 13.2%
  • Black or African American: 3.9%
  • Hispanic or Latino: 57.9%
  • White: 17.1%
  • Non-Resident Alien: 1.3%
  • Other Races: 6.6%

Jobs for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ician Grads in California

16,280 people in the state and 256,040 in the nation are employed in jobs related to electrocardiograph technology/technician.

undefined

Wages for Electrocardiograph Technology/Technician Jobs in California

In this state, electrocardiograph technology/technician grads earn an average of $72,960. Nationwide, they make an average of $58,730.
